Haiku offer a different perspective. When written about classic novels, they force the writer to pick out the most important elements. For instance, in a haiku for 'Wuthering Heights', it might highlight the wild love and the moors. This helps in understanding as it strips away the excess and leaves only the crucial parts. It's like a spotlight on the novel's essence.

Quotes can give us a quick glimpse into the main themes. For example, in '1984' by George Orwell, the quote 'Big Brother is watching you' immediately tells us about the overarching theme of surveillance and a totalitarian regime. It makes us aware of the atmosphere of the novel.

To enhance understanding through readings of classic short stories, you should first read them carefully more than once. Notice the plot development, how the conflict is introduced and resolved. In 'A Good Man Is Hard to Find', the grandmother's actions and the events that unfold on their journey are crucial. Then, consider the author's use of language, such as symbolism and imagery.
